Hi all,

i've applied Moritz's patch to make use of the new Secure storage in Equinox/Ganymede.

Concretely this means that the Globus/Voms/Gria/AWS toke creation wizards will request the Eclipse's secure store password and try to fetch passwords from there, resulting in those passwords persisting across gEclipse sessions.

BUT i am not sure how RCP developers will be afected by this... probably gLite/GRIA not at all because IIRC only the UI components make use of the PasswordManager in those implemenations.

Secure Storage preferences can be found in Preferences / General / Security / Secure Storage
